Moreover, How big is Hillsborough Community College campus? The answer is: During 2020-2021, the median age of HCC students is 21. attended HCC in 2019-2020. The college owns approximately 422 acres of land, which include 65 buildings and 1.8 million square feet of space. HCC’s intercollegiate teams include men’s basketball and baseball and women’s volleyball, basketball, softball and tennis.

Simply so, How much does Hillsborough Community College cost?
Answer to this: The highest degree offered at Hillsborough Community College is an associate degree. The school has an open admissions policy and offers credit for life experiences. The in-state tuition and fees for 2018-2019 were $2,506, and out-of-state tuition and fees were $9,111. There is no application fee.

What race is Hillsborough Community College?
The response is: The enrolled student population at Hillsborough Community College, both undergraduate and graduate, is 35.7% Hispanic or Latino, 34.4% White, 17.6% Black or African American, 4.11% Two or More Races, 3.19% Asian, 0.251% American Indian or Alaska Native, and 0.205%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islanders.

Interesting fact: HCC was one of the last community colleges to be created in Florida, founded in 1968. Only Pasco–Hernando State College, out of the 28-school Florida community college system, was founded later. In January 2008 the school opened its first residence hall, Hawk’s Landing, named after the school mascot. This marks HCC as one of the few community colleges with its own residence hall. [2]
